Company ordered to continue paying wages during jury duty

The employers of a juror in the Kieran Keane murder trial have been ordered to continue to pay his wages for the duration of the trial.

Officials from the company appeared at Cloverhill Court, in Dublin, where the instruction was given by Justice Paul Carney.
